Why Are Creators Uniquely Challenged by Finances?

Creators face a set of financial challenges that differ significantly from traditional freelancers, small businesses, or W2 employees:

  • Income Volatility: Revenue can vary wildly month to month based on algorithm changes, sponsorships, virality, or seasonality.
  • Multi-Source Revenue: A creator might earn from five to ten different channels, each with different payout structures, fees, and schedules.
  • Tax Complexity: Without employer withholding, quarterly taxes become a guessing game, and mistakes can be costly.
  • Blurred Business Expenses: Many purchases straddle the line between personal and business use, leading to ambiguity in deductions.
  • Time Drain: Every hour spent on admin is an hour not spent on creating, engaging, or growing.

This complex blend of volatility, multi-platform operations, and minimal financial support creates a perfect storm of administrative burden. For creators, it's not just about saving money—it's about saving time and sanity.

Who Are the Founders of Beluga Labs?

The Beluga Labs founding team blends technical innovation with deep go-to-market insight, bringing a unique advantage to the problem space.

Jack Swisher, Co-Founder and CTO

Jack’s technical background is grounded in AI and automation. He studied Computer Science and Statistics at Harvard, where he wrote his thesis on evaluating generative models. At Bubble, he co-led R&D for a text-to-app generator in a no-code environment. He’s passionate about applying cutting-edge AI to solve practical, messy real-world problems—starting with creator finances.

Fernando Young, Co-Founder and CEO

Fernando studied Sociology at Harvard and sharpened his business acumen with coursework at MIT Sloan. His professional career spans sales leadership roles at HubSpot, Meta, and Dare Drop, where he worked directly on creator monetization strategies. His deep understanding of creator pain points fuels Beluga’s customer-first strategy.

Together, the pair is building a solution that’s both technically robust and market-validated, with strong founder-market fit.
